Storage:
 
CR4 antibody should be stored long term (months) at -80 ˚C and short term (days) at 4 ˚C. As with all antibodies avoid freeze/thaw cycles.

Application Note:
CCR4 antibody can be used in immunohistochemistry starting at 10 μg/mL.

Immunogen:
CCR4 antibody was raised against a peptide located in the 2nd extracellular domain of CCR4 (Human).
